Healthcare at Moorhouse

Our Health & Care sector plays a central role in designing and delivering transformation across the NHS. We work with organisations across the UK health system, including national bodies, ICSe and providers to solve their most critical challenges - including improving operational performance, redesigning care pathways, delivering digital and data-enabled transformation, and defining operating models and supporting organisation-wide change. We combine national-level strategy experience with hands-on delivery in provider settings, focusing on three core areas aligned to NHS 10-year plan priorities:

  • Health Service Optimisation: Operational, performance and financial improvement across acute, community and primary care settings.
  • Digital, Data and AI transformation: to support improved decision-making, productivity and performance improvement across care systems.
  • Health System Strategy and Design: Commissioning and system strategy and design, helping ICSe and national bodies redesign care pathways, allocate resources effectively, and drive system-wide transformation.

We have long-standing partnerships with many of the largest NHS organisations on programmes ranging from system-wide change to targeted improvement work, helping them maximise value, strengthen resilience and improve outcomes for patients and populations.

Essential skills

What are we looking for? We are seeking a Manager with strong financial expertise, grounded in work in the NHS and consulting experience and the ability to shape and deliver large-scale transformation programmes. Candidates should bring 6-8 years' experience in healthcare consulting and/or NHS financial management or improvement, with a track record of delivering measurable impact.

The experience you will bring:

  • Fully qualified accountant (CIPFA or CIMA preferred). ACA or ACCA also considered where candidates can demonstrate strong NHS sector experience and/or consulting or professional services background.
  • Deep experience delivering financial improvement programmes in the NHS, including CIP/ FIP or broader cost-reduction initiatives, with the ability to design pragmatic and actionable solutions for providers and systems.
  • Strong financial acumen, including interpreting budgets, developing financial models, and working alongside finance teams to understand drivers of expenditure, productivity and efficiency.
  • Ability to diagnose root causes, synthesise complex financial and operational data, and translate findings into compelling recommendations for executives.
  • Experience advising NHS provider and system-level leaders, including CFOs, COOs and programme directors, with credibility and confidence when engaging senior stakeholders.
  • Understanding of NHS financial frameworks, funding flows and contracting mechanisms, and the ability to apply these to design financially sustainable service models and improvement plans.
  • Experience or exposure to NHS business cases (SOC, OBC, FBC), including clear articulation of the strategic, economic, commercial, financial and management cases, and ensuring these are evidence based and aligned to national guidance (e.g., HM Treasury Green Book).
  • Ability to shape go-to-market financial propositions, contributing to bids, identifying new opportunities, and articulating how financial improvement aligns with system-level transformation and provider priorities.
